MY TEDx TALK

A Mom Can't Always Act Like A Grown Up Here's Why.

When it comes to parenting, why is it so hard for a mom to always be the bigger person? And how come our kids often evoke such childlike feelings in us? These are just some of the questions addressed in my Tedx Talk, by taking you on a journey deep into the mind of a mother. Here I investigate the invisible forces that operate between mother and child, and the secret internal spaces where kids run riot and normal rules don’t apply.

MY BOOK

Parenting Psychoanalysed: Letters To A Parent

The first book of its kind, Parenting Psychoanalysed: Letters to a Parent (Routledge 2025) collates the musings of a thoughtful group of psychoanalysts with a series of candid letters, each addressing the aspect of parenthood they most want to share and what they wish they knew before becoming a parent.

​

Written in the simplest of terms, each contributor shares a letter that reflects both personally and professionally on parenthood, sharing their feelings, insights and psychoanalytic reflections with the parent-reader. Drawing on their deep understanding of the mind and the personal work done on themselves, each writer digests what it really means to be a parent, what they didn’t expect when they were expecting, the pleasures and anxieties of parenting, the ordinary ambiguities and ambivalence evoked by their children at various life stages, as well as many other gems that no other parenting books are talking about. This international collection begins an important conversation with mothers, fathers and caregivers; encouraging them to consider how their inner worlds, worries and wishes matter deeply and hold important clues about how to parent in an open and authentic way. Each letter shows how understanding this dynamic is key to raising a healthy, balanced family and living more freely.

​

This thought-provoking book connects parents through personal stories and profound psychoanalytic insights, and is an essential read for every mother, father and caregiver.
